CHANGE: America’s Slow Descent To Second-Class Status. “It is undeniable that we are on the path to fiscal collapse. This decline will occur in two stages. First there is the decay as the swelling national debt wears away the economy’s foundations and commits more and more future income to foreign creditors. We are already in stage one. In stage two a lethal combination of phenomena arises in quick succession: greater default risk, looming inflation, higher interest rates, declining growth, financial market instability, and an acceleration of government borrowing. They feed on each other. The economy heads on a downward spiral. Between stage one and stage two there is a tipping point. Experts know it will come, but nobody wants to predict when.”

BUBONIC PLAGUE CAME FROM CHINA: “The first outbreak of plague occurred in China more than 2,600 years ago before reaching Europe via Central Asia’s ‘Silk Road’ trade route, according to a study of the disease’s DNA signature.”
